问题标签 [pyvmomi]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python - 如何将虚拟机克隆到特定的数据存储?
我想使用 pyvmomi 克隆虚拟机并将其附加到特定的数据存储(特别是具有最多可用空间)。
我在 pysphere 中找不到解决方案,因此我尝试使用 pyvmomi 运气,但似乎这个库的学习曲线有点陡峭。
有什么帮助吗?
python - 如何使用 Pyvmomi 创建带有 vmdk 磁盘的 VM(不是克隆)?
我正在尝试使用 Pyvmomi 创建一个新的虚拟机。我成功地创建了带有 RAM 和 CPU 的 VM,但我找不到有关如何创建带有附加磁盘的 VM 的文档。我希望创建一个具有 20GB 精简配置 HDD 的 VM,但我找不到有关如何执行此操作的文档。
这就是我正在使用的:
python - 有没有办法使用 pyvmomi API 删除来宾虚拟机?
我一直在翻阅官方 VMWare pyvmomi API 的文档和示例,在我的一生中,我找不到一个明显的方法来将虚拟机从 ESXi 服务器中删除。
任何人都可以提供一个例子或将我指向已经实现这个的人 - 似乎唯一的选择是自己推出一些东西
- 关闭虚拟机
- 注销它
- 删除虚拟机
- 删除与 VM 关联的磁盘?
我认为每个部分都在那里,但我真的希望有人能指出我正确的方向。
python - pyvmomi 获取 RAM/CPU 使用情况 VSphere SDK 5.5?
我正在尝试通过 Python 从一些 ESXi 服务器获取一些信息。我发现 pyvmomi( https://github.com/vmware/pyvmomi ) 是一个很棒且易于理解的工具。但是,我似乎找不到获取有关 CPU/RAM/存储使用情况的“实时”信息的方法。我正在浏览 VMware 的 SDK(http://pubs.vmware.com/vsphere-55/topic/com.vmware.sdk.doc/GUID-19793BCA-9EAB-42E2-8B9F-F9F2129E7741.html),但我可以只查找主机有多少 cpu 或多少内存。
有没有人通过 Python 做到这一点?
vmware - 如何使用 pyvmomi 创建虚拟机快照
我的任务是在 django 应用程序中实现基本的备份和恢复系统。我听说过 pyvmomi,但之前从未使用过。我手头的具体任务是:
1) 调用 vCenter,传递 vm 名称,并请求创建快照 2) 获取快照的文件位置 3) 并将快照文件上传到 OpenStack Swift 对象存储
使用 pyvmomi 创建 vm 快照的实际语法是什么?另外 - 从 vCenter 请求实际快照文件的语法是什么?
pyvmomi - 输入 pyvmomi 示例请求的页面是什么
我想请求一个 pyvmomi 示例,该示例将演示如何创建 VM 快照。我可以用来输入此类请求的网页是什么?
python - 使用 pyVmomi 将孤立的虚拟机添加到清单?
在过去的一两天里,我在这里和优秀的 ole Google 上都做了很多研究,似乎找不到任何使用 pyVmomi(或任何其他 vSphere 模块)将孤立虚拟机添加到库存的示例.
感谢 github 上的一些示例,我能够使用 pyVmomi 找到孤立的 vm,但是 man.. pyVmomi 没有任何好的文档。
所以,现在我要发布我自己的问题!
感谢您的任何提示/帮助!
——克里斯·穆里纳
python - 使用 .vmx 和 .vmdk 文件中的 pyvmomi 模块创建 vm
我一直在尝试使用 pyvmomi 模块在 Python 中使用来自 ESX 主机的现有 vm 的 .vmx 和 .vmdk 文件来创建一个新的 vm。我是 pyvmomi 的新手,没有太多可用于 pyvmomi 的在线帮助。我已经检查了 github 中的示例代码(https://github.com/vmware/pyvmomi-community-samples/tree/298bf74446f3fcc5743d6435763ff6dc16ab4cbc/samples),但没有找到相关的东西。请给我指点。
python - 从工具导入任务,ImportError: cannot import name tasks
尝试执行此示例代码,因为我需要使用pyvmomi
. 但是在开始时执行失败并from tools import tasks
出现错误: ImportError: cannot import name tasks。
我已经尝试了很长时间,但无法解决错误。我在 centOS 6.4 上有 python 2.7
工具模块已安装但tasks.py
内部没有/usr/local/lib/python2.7/site-packages/tools/
不确定必须安装哪些工具包。请指导。